Our focus is to teach the foundations of CrossFit – Eat meat and vegetables, nuts and seeds, some fruit, little starch and no sugar. Keep intake to levels that will support exercise but not body fat. Practice and train major lifts: Deadlift, clean, squat, presses, C&J, and snatch. Similarly, master the basics of gymnastics: pull-ups ...
WebFounded in 2000 by Greg Glassman and Lauren Jenai, CrossFit has grown to become a worldwide sensation - from having 250 affiliate gyms in 2007 to over 9,000 in 2014. So how did a fitness concept that originated from a single gym in Santa Cruz, California turn into a massive cult-like phenomenon 15 years later? 1.
